Buying Guide
- Application environment: Choose IP-rated units (IP68 for water exposure; IPX8 for outdoor wet use) to ensure durability in the operating environment.
- Liquid compatibility: Verify that the meter supports your liquids (water, diesel, gasoline, kerosene, methanol, chemicals). Some meters specify non-potable or restricted use with drinking water.
- Accuracy and range: Look for ±1% accuracy and a flow range that matches your typical delivery or consumption rates to maximize precision and avoid oversizing.
- Materials and protection: Aluminum housings offer ruggedness; PP plastic is lighter and chemical-tolerant but not for high temperatures. EMI protection helps in environments with electrical interference.
- Display and units: An LCD display with real-time flow, totals, and a choice of units (GAL, QTS, PTS, L, m³) aids in quick interpretation and logging.
- Maintenance: Consider ease of battery replacement and whether the meter can stay installed during service. Auto-off features can save power in outdoor deployments.
- Installation: Inline NPT connections and 3/4″ adapters increase compatibility with existing piping. A swivel connector can ease alignment during setup.
- Safety and compliance: For fuel measurements, ensure the device is rated for the specific fuel type and conforms to relevant safety standards in your region.
